The Environmental and Safety Aspects of N-Propyl Acetate
At NINGBO INNO PHARMCHEM CO.,LTD., we prioritize the safe and responsible use of all chemicals, including n-Propyl Acetate (CAS 109-60-4). While n-Propyl Acetate is a highly effective solvent and flavoring agent, understanding its environmental and safety aspects is crucial for its proper handling and application. This colorless liquid is classified as flammable due to its low flash point, necessitating precautions against ignition sources.
Safety data sheets (SDS) for n-Propyl Acetate detail recommended handling procedures, including the use of appropriate personal protective equipment (PPE) such as gloves, safety glasses, and proper ventilation to avoid inhalation of vapors. Its mild odor, while pleasant, should not be a basis for complacency; adequate ventilation in workplaces is always recommended. For industrial buyers, accessing and understanding the SDS provided by NINGBO INNO PHARMCHEM CO.,LTD. is a key step in ensuring workplace safety.
From an environmental perspective, n-Propyl Acetate is considered to have a moderate evaporation rate, and while it has limited water solubility, appropriate disposal methods must be followed to prevent environmental contamination. Information regarding its biodegradability suggests it can be broken down in the environment.
